a,a:active,a:focus,a:hover,body,p{font-weight:300}.hs-button{align-items:center;display:inline-flex!important;height:50px}form .hs-button,form input[type=submit]{font-size:16px;font-weight:300}p{font-size:18px}.header,tfoot td{background-color:transparent;padding:2rem 0;position:absolute;top:0;width:100%}#hs_cos_wrapper_button{padding:.7rem .875rem}@media (max-width:768px){.header,tfoot td{padding:0}}.header__container.content-wrapper{align-items:center;border:1px solid #ffffff38;border-radius:10px;display:flex;padding:1rem}@media (max-width:767px){.header__container{border:none!important;border-bottom:1px solid #ffffff59!important;border-radius:0!important;flex-direction:row;padding:1rem!important}.header__navigation--toggle.open{display:contents}.header__navigation--toggle:after{display:none!important}.header__language-switcher.open,.header__navigation.open,.header__search.open{min-height:auto}.header__row-2{flex-direction:row-reverse}.menu__link{color:#24315e}.hs-button{font-size:12px;padding:4px 20px}}.hs-button{border-radius:5px;font-size:16px}.hs-button.secondary-btn{background:#fef5b5;border:1px solid #fef5b5;color:#24315e}.hs-button.secondary-btn:hover{background:#fff;border:1px solid #24315e;color:#24315e}.hs-button.white-btn{background:#fff;border:1px solid #fff;color:#24315e}.hs-button.white-btn:hover{background:#fef5b5;border:1px solid #fef5b5;color:#24315e}.hs-button.transparent-btn{background:transparent;border:1px solid #f86c6e;color:#f86c6e}.hs-button.transparent-btn:hover{background:#fef5b5;border:1px solid #fef5b5;color:#24315e}.global-footer-outer .col3 h6{margin-bottom:10px}.vertical-align-space-bet .tpi-column-1{display:flex;flex-direction:column;justify-content:space-between}.module_17465396036223 .tpi-column-1{width:54%!important}@media (max-width:768px){.module_17465396036223 .tpi-column-1{width:100%!important}}@media (min-width:769px) and (max-width:1199px){.row-number-9.dnd_area-row-4-margin{margin-bottom:0!important}}.column2-top-margin .tpi-column-2 .hs_cos_wrapper_type_inline_rich_text{margin-top:11px}@media (max-width:768px){.overflow-img-section-hm .tpi-main{flex-direction:column-reverse!important}.hs-content-id-190081602087 .dnd_area-row-1-margin{margin-top:0!important}}@media (min-width:768px) and (max-width:1080px){.hs-content-id-190081602087 .dnd_area-row-1-margin{margin-top:285px!important}}